Career Path

Trade Compliance Specialist: Ensures adherence to international trade regulations and policies, minimizing legal risks for businesses.

International Trade Lawyer: Provides legal expertise on cross-border transactions, trade disputes, and compliance with global trade laws.

Global Supply Chain Manager: Oversees the efficient movement of goods across international borders, optimizing logistics and reducing costs.

Export Control Officer: Manages export licenses and ensures compliance with export regulations to prevent unauthorized shipments.

Customs Broker: Facilitates the clearance of goods through customs, ensuring compliance with import/export laws and tariffs.
